Big Lake's Climate Is Harder on Siding Than It Looks
Big Lake sits in a part of Skagit County where the weather rarely does anything dramatic — no hurricanes, no extreme heat — but it also almost never lets a house dry out completely. Moist Pacific air moves up the Skagit Valley for most of the year, driving rain comes in sideways during fall and winter storms, and the tree cover around the lake keeps humidity and shade lingering on north- and west-facing walls long after the sun comes back out. Add in a moss season that can run from October through April, and you have conditions that punish any siding material with a weak point in its water management, finish, or fastening.
This isn't a coastal salt-spray environment in the way a beachfront home on the Sound experiences it, but the same marine air mass that carries moisture and salt off Puget Sound pushes inland through the valley, and homes around Big Lake still deal with airborne moisture, algae growth, and slow-drying wall assemblies. Siding here needs to shed water fast, resist moss and mildew on its face, and hold its finish without cracking or peeling for decades — not just survive one wet winter.

Why We Only Install James Hardie Fiber Cement
We don't install vinyl, LP SmartSide, cedar, primed spruce, Cemplank, or Allura. That's a deliberate standard, not a sales pitch, and it's worth explaining honestly rather than just asserting it.
Vinyl is inexpensive and low-maintenance in mild climates, but it expands and contracts with temperature swings, can warp or crack in a hard freeze, and its seams and J-channels give moisture more places to collect in a wet climate like ours. Wood products — cedar and primed spruce — look great fresh off the truck, but they're organic material in a region built for moss and mildew; they need real maintenance discipline (recoating, caulking, moisture monitoring) to avoid rot, and most homeowners don't keep up with that schedule for 20+ years. Engineered wood siding like LP SmartSide performs better than raw wood in many ways, but it's still wood-based, and its long-term moisture resistance depends heavily on installation quality and ongoing upkeep. Other fiber cement brands (Cemplank, Allura) are chemically similar to Hardie, but we don't have the same track record, factory finish system, or local supply and warranty support with them that we have with James Hardie.
James Hardie's fiber cement is non-combustible, dimensionally stable in wet-dry cycles, and available in HZ5 formulations engineered for the Pacific Northwest's freeze-thaw and moisture profile. Its ColorPlus factory finish is baked on and warranted separately from the substrate, which matters in a climate where field-applied paint tends to fail early on the north side of a house. Installed correctly, it's the product we're willing to put our name behind for the long haul — which is why it's the only thing we install.
What "Correct Installation" Actually Means Here
Water Management Behind the Siding
Most siding failures we get called out to inspect aren't a problem with the siding material — they're a problem with what's behind it. A correct James Hardie install starts with a drainable weather-resistive barrier, properly lapped and taped seams, and rainscreen furring or a comparable drainage gap on walls that hold moisture longer, particularly the shaded sides of a home near the lake and tree line.
Flashing and Trim Details
Every window, door, and roofline intersection is a place water wants to get behind the siding. We flash head, jamb, and sill details per Hardie's published specifications, not shortcuts, and we use trim and caulking systems that move with the building instead of cracking after one winter.
Fastening and Clearances
Hardie siding has to be fastened at the correct spacing and depth, with the right gap at the bottom for drainage and clearance from grade, decks, and roof lines. Nailing it too tight, too loose, or too close to the edge is a common cause of buckling and cracking that gets blamed on the product when it's actually an installation error.
Caulking and Sealant Discipline
We caulk joints and penetrations with sealants rated for our climate and Hardie's specifications, not general-purpose caulk that hardens and cracks within a couple of freeze-thaw cycles.
Choosing the Right Hardie Product for a Big Lake Home
Hardie makes several product lines, and the right one depends on your home's style, sun and shade exposure, and how much of the lake-adjacent tree cover surrounds the lot.
| Product | Best Fit For | Why It Works Here |
|---|---|---|
| HardiePlank lap siding | Most single-family homes, traditional and craftsman styles | Classic look, strong track record in wet PNW climates, wide color range |
| HardiePanel vertical siding | Modern builds, accent walls, gable ends | Fewer horizontal ledges for moss and debris to collect on |
| HardieShingle | Cottage or lake-house style homes | Textured look without the maintenance burden of real cedar shingle |
| HardieTrim | Corners, window and door surrounds, fascia | Matches fiber cement durability so trim doesn't fail before the field siding does |
For most Big Lake homes we recommend HZ5-engineered product with a ColorPlus finish in a color built to resist visible moss growth and UV fade, since shaded, tree-lined lots hold moisture and grime longer than open exposures.

Living With Hardie Siding in Skagit County
One advantage of ColorPlus-finished Hardie is how little upkeep it actually needs compared to wood or a repainted surface. A simple annual routine keeps it performing the way it's designed to:
- Rinse the siding with a garden hose once or twice a year, focusing on shaded and north-facing walls where moss and grime build up fastest
- Keep gutters clear so overflow doesn't run down the face of the siding during heavy storms
- Trim back trees and shrubs so foliage isn't holding moisture against the wall
- Inspect and re-caulk joints around windows, doors, and trim every few years
- Address any impact damage or cracked caulk promptly rather than letting water find its way behind the panel
- Avoid pressure washing directly at seams and edges — a garden hose and soft brush are enough
That's it. No recoating schedule, no annual sealing, no chasing rot before it spreads — which is a real difference from wood siding maintenance over a 20-30 year span.
